When Greenbelt Construction Company began building houses in a large subdivision with many other builders, the company priced it

s homes slightly higher than its competitors and promoted the added quality features found in Greenbelt's homes. Greenbelt was using a(n) ________ pricing strategy.
Social Studies
1 answer:
Misha Larkins [42]2 years ago
6 0

Answer: Greenbelt was using a COMPETITIVE BASED pricing strategy.

Explanation:

This is a pricing strategy in which the company looks at the pricing of the other companies who operates in the same industry and then taking that to influence their own pricing. They do this by searching in the information that the other businesses advertised without really knowing what strategies were used by these companies,so they use the publicised Information and to also find what features are there in their competitors so that they may add something diffrent or keep it the same.

Greenbelt priced its homes slightly higher than its competitors and promoted the added quality features , the method of promoting the added quality features is to let people compare with the competitors and see that Greenbelt has added something diffrent and of quality and they can possibly beat their competitors in the same area.

A child smiles and gains attention from a caretaker, so the child begins to smile more often. This is an example of _______.
Nataly [62]

Answer:

B. Operant conditioning

Explanation:

In psychology, the term operant conditioning refers to a form of learning by reinforcements and punishments.

According to this, a reinforcement is an stimulus that increases the probability that a certain behavior takes place again in a future, so, <u>when the individual is presented with this stimulus, the behavior will be more likely repeated in the future and it will happen more often.</u>

In this example a child smiles and gains attention, <u>the reinforcement would be the gaining of attention, which would be the stimulus that is making the child to begin to smile more often</u>. Gaining attention is something desirable and pleasant for the child so it's a reinforcement for the conduct of smiling.

Therefore this is an example of b. operant conditioning.
